Anthony Joshua’s £150 Million Real Estate Investment in London

How Anthony Joshua Became ‘The Landlord’ of London’s Property Market

Boxing champion Anthony Joshua has been expanding his real estate investments in London, reportedly spending around £150 million over the past 18 months.

Known among his inner circle as “The Landlord,” Joshua has strategically built a property portfolio that includes high-value commercial buildings, such as a £25 million property on New Bond Street and another worth £30 million in Hertfordshire, which was formerly the headquarters of BP.

These investments reflect Joshua’s keen interest in securing his financial future beyond boxing. He has also invested in various residential properties, including homes in North London and Watford.

His calculated moves in real estate demonstrate his desire to build wealth through diverse streams, alongside his impressive earnings from his boxing career​.
